Common Mistakes in Software Application Development

Common Mistakes in Software Application Development 1

Software program development is the procedure of developing software application for a details function. In this process, developers compose code based upon firm treatments and also item specs. Front-end programmers create interface, while back-end developers build applications. Database administrators keep appropriate data in data sources. Developers collaborate to evaluate each various other’s code. The last execution stage includes releasing the software product to the setting. The developers test the program’s performance in a pilot version before it enters into manufacturing. If you loved this article and also you would like to be given more info about click here for info i implore you to visit our own web site.

Needs analysis

The success of a software program project relies on the performance of the requirements evaluation process. The application of a function may not meet all the expectations of stakeholders, as well as missed out on demands evaluation can cause economic losses and also also legal activities. An effectively carried out requirements analysis procedure can stop this from happening. In this short article, we’ll go over just how to perform an effective needs analysis. In-depth conversations with stakeholders are essential to an effective task.

Style

Software application style is an essential stage during the software advancement process. In the design stage, top-level attributes are defined for the application. Next, shipment services and application framework are produced. Lastly, impact evaluation is carried out to identify the software’s worth. In the early phases, customer research is crucial to the success of the task. Numerous mistakes can make software advancement less efficient. Below are some instances of typical errors in software development:

Coding

Coding is the procedure of converting human language code to maker language. This process involves the evaluation and also concept of the software application program, its debugging, assembling, screening, as well as execution. There are numerous devices offered to make the coding procedure less complicated. You can utilize easy message editors, yet advanced programming devices like Eclipse, Bootstrap, Delphi, as well as the C++ language are better. Coding specialists should have a broad expertise of hardware requirements and also the fundamentals of writing a program.

Documents

Documentation throughout software development includes all documents concerning the process of establishing as well as maintaining a software application. Developers start to create procedure documentation as very early as the preliminary idea phase, and also proceed to add essential info via each phase of the growth procedure. This documentation guides the team throughout the process as well as aids them complete the task’s objectives as quickly and also efficiently as possible. Developers likewise prepare quotes for documentation, also called initiative evaluation, in order to far better plan their spending plans, choose groups, and identify prices.

Examining

Among the most essential stages throughout the software advancement process is testing. Without testing, the software program would certainly not be dependable adequate to be made use of by customers. QA screening makes sure that applications are operating correctly also under less-than-ideal problems. This phase is vital to making sure the safety and protection of your software application. It includes coding as well as decoding. The tests need to be designed to validate that your software program will certainly not break or collapse in any kind of situation.

Maintenance

The Maintenance of Software Application Growth (SM) procedure is a fundamental part of the software program advancement lifecycle. It entails numerous tasks, such as identifying troubles, repairing them, as well as enhancing the software program’s efficiency. It needs to be done throughout the entire growth cycle and occupies 40-80% of a job’s overall cost. Upkeep tasks have to be tactical as well as documented, which needs comprehensive research and evaluation. Furthermore, they have to get all the needed permissions and documents. If you cherished this write-up and you would like to receive a lot more details about Analytics kindly take a look at the internet site.

If you are interested in the content for this post, here are a couple even more webpages with a similar content material:

simply click the next website

Highly recommended Site

Common Mistakes in Software Application Development 2